Abbott Assistant Accounting (Reporting) Manager in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am
M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ES :
Reporting
Manage corporate reporting (HFM Oracle) and US GAAP financial statements.
Manage local and US GAAP chart of accounts.
Manage VAS financial statements and other related statutory financial reports.
Manage VAS reporting system and ensure the smooth working of VAS reporting system on ERP.
Month-end and year-end closing
Prepare monthly and yearly financial performance update deck in term of B/S, P&L, sales performance analysis, WC, SG&A, trade spending for operational review purpose.
Manage periodic closing process to ensure all accounting recorded properly and reporting submitted timely.
Financial accounting compliance & process
Responsible for coordinating cross-functions in finance to further improve end-to-end process.
Understanding system to enhance system control & automation.
Work with external audit for US GAAP and statutory auditing, SOX documentation and Testing and Corporate Internal audit.
Budget & Planning
Handle B/S forecast and analyze variance between actual vs. forecast.
Handle CFS budget, rLBE forecast and analyze variance between actual vs. forecast.
Handle quarterly statutory P&L forecast for management review and tax planning purpose.
Execute the finance related requests/new standards instructed by Area/Corp (e.g revenue recognition, transfer price update, etc.).
Talent Management
- Build up the successor pipeline for RTR Team.
MINIMUM BACKGROUND/ EXPERIENCE REQUIRED :
Bachelor Degree in Accounting or Financerequired.
5-6 years of experience in Finance & Accounting with experience in FMCG is preferable. ACCA or CPA is an advantage.
Good knowledge in US GAAP, VAS and tax laws/regulations.
Proficiency in Microsoft Office, particularly in Excel.
Strong financial analytical skills, ability to manage multiple tasks and prioritize workloads.
Strong communication skills, both written and verbal. Good command in English.
Logical thinking. Quick learning. Have a can-do attitude. Hard-working.
